She has benefited from her work with many great mentors over the years – Heidi Peterson Barrett, David Abreu and Michel Rolland. Although all of these experiences taught her about vineyard selection and winemaking techniques, she quickly cultivated a style of her own. Her wines have set a new standard for Napa Cabernet, and also for Rhône varieties grown in the rugged terroir of California’s Sierra Nevada Mountain Range. In Wine Spectator’s 2014 cover story spotlighting Helen Keplinger, wine critic James Laube wrote that Helen’s Keplinger label is “one of the most exciting and innovative wineries to emerge in California in years.” In a region that largely hangs its hat on high-end Cabernet, this is without a doubt a grape that Helen has had soaring success with over the years crafting wines for Bryant Family, Grace Family Vineyards, Kerr and Waterfall. However, she’s also gone out of her way to seek out the most unique sites planted with Rhône varieties to try her hand at something new. 

Today, both Helen’s single-vineyard Cabernet Sauvignon and Rhône expressions under her namesake label, KEPLINGER, are some of the best in the United States, if not the world. Helen's 2018 Lithic ~ meaning "from stone" ~ is a blend of 46% Grenache, 35% Mourvèdre, and 19% Syrah, coming from Ann Kraemer’s incredible Shake Ridge Vineyard situated at 1,700 feet in the Sierra Foothills of Amador County. Organically farmed to perfection, the extraordinary Sierra uplift soils, loaded with quartz, basalt and soapstone always combine to create wines of great purity, richness, and minerality. The Grenache, Mourvèdre, and Syrah blocks are all on rock-filled slopes with excellent exposure and drainage. The hillside blocks were harvested in partial picks for optimal ripeness on four different dates, then combined into small co-fermentations. The wine was aged in a combination of 20% new and neutral French oak barrels for 18 months before being bottled without fining or filtration.
